FOCUS AND SCOPE

DIROSAT: Journal of Education, Social Sciences & Humanities aims to serve as a cohesive scholarly platform for the dissemination of information and research on Education, Social Sciences & Humanities, incorporating original peer-reviewed research, case studies, reports and book reviews from a manifold of international authors.

Focus
DIROSAT: Journal of Education, Social Sciences & Humanities specific focus are as follows:

  • To provide a reputable and acclaimed forum for the publication of high-quality research in the areas of Education, Social Sciences & Humanities.
  • To advance discussions on new theoretical and empirical understanding on contemporary issues in Education, Social Sciences & Humanities.
  • To promote extensive exchange of information among scholars and experts in the multidisciplinary fields of Education, Social Sciences & Humanities at both the local and international levels, without limitation to the Southeast Asian region.
  • To disseminate pioneering research that scrutinizes the interconnection and interplay of prevalent issues from the Education, Social Sciences & Humanities perspectives.

Scope
DIROSAT: Journal of Education, Social Sciences & Humanities warmly welcomes contributions from scholars of related disciplines:
